Stocks are mostly categorised as per their market capitalisation, also known as market cap. Market cap is a reflection of the company’s size. The three main stock classifications according to market cap are large-cap, mid-cap, and small-cap. A company’s size is a crucial factor to be considered while choosing stocks for investment. What are Large Cap Funds?

Large cap funds are mutual funds that primarily invest in stocks of companies that have large market capitalization. Large cap companies are those which are well-established in the business segment and have a long positive track record. These companies have good corporate-governance and wealth-generation is often a slow and steady process. ​ 

Why invest in Large cap funds?

Since large-sized companies have a steady performance, investors can expect regular dividend payouts. As far as the risk-return is concerned, large-cap funds have mostly steady returns with a lower risk factor as compared to mid-cap and small-cap funds. Here are some features which make large cap funds an ideal investment choice:

  • Large cap funds normally see significant capital growth apart from offering stability to investors. 
  • The investment value of large-cap funds is usually unaffected by frequent market volatility. These offer some level of security to investors as the NAV of such funds is mostly stable.
  • Investors who are looking for diversification with moderate to low risk can opt for large-cap funds.
  • Investors can expect returns in the long term. These are not ideal for investors who are looking for immediate profits.

Things to Consider Before investing in Large Cap Funds

Large Cap Funds offer steady returns with comparatively lower risk. To gain good returns, investors should consider a five to seven-year horizon while investing in large cap funds. Here are some of the important things to consider before investing in these funds:

  • Large Cap funds are not risk-proof: Large Cap equity funds do have several risks that are mainly market-related. However, these risks are significantly moderate as compared to small-cap or mid-cap funds.
  • Consider the expense ratio: Large Cap funds do have expenses related to fund management. This affects the expense ratio of the fund. Hence, while choosing a fund, look for a lower expense ratio which can help in fetching higher profits.
  • Work better for a longer investment horizon: Large Cap equity funds can fetch good returns in the medium to long run. It makes sense to remain invested for least three to five years in large cap funds so as to get reasonable returns.
  • Are subject to Capital Gains Tax: Large Cap funds are subject to the same tax treatment as any other equity asset. Long term capital gains (LTCG) is applicable for an investment period of more than one year.

  • What is the meaning of blue-chip funds?

Blue-chip is a term used for financially strong and well-established companies. A fund that invests primarily in blue-chip stocks is known as a blue-chip fund.
